OK....FINALLY. Here's the deal on the TMP mesh head. i.e. things they don't explain to you. 

1. YES....you must buy a head skin separately. That's right. The head does not come with skin.
2. You have to go into the other boutique and choose a FACE which is also the skin....they don't explain that.
3. You MUST BUY the face after you decide what skin tone you want your body and buy that same color. i.e. you must chose the same color. BECAUSE if you don't your head won't match your body. That's right....the head is not editable.
4. You MUST BUY a hair base also. If you don't then you won't be able to wear hair. When applying your hair do NOT click "wear". Your head will disappear. Click "add".

OK....FINALLY. Here's the deal on the TMP mesh head. i.e. things they don't explain to you. 

1. YES....you must buy a head skin separately. That's right. The head does not come with skin.

That is true for all mesh heads and mesh bodies although most come with a few basic default skins you can use in an emergency and, even more important, most support the general Omega applier system so there's a huge selection to choose from.

TMP doesn't though, they have their own rather awkward applier system and very few clothes and skin creators bother with it these days.

- Store an absolute eye-watering nightmare to navigate
- Completely proprietary system that's incompatible with every other system
- Can only buy via adding cash to their own payment system, in certain increments that can usually never be fully spent (because most things cost odd amounts), but you can't get that excess money back
- Only updated once (over two years ago) and still not Bento-compatible. Bento was promised in their last Facebook update... in December 2015.
- Basic body for women (L$2500) has an alpha HUD. Basic body for men does not; men have to buy the Deluxe body (L$5000) to get an alpha HUD
- Creators had to give their textures full-permission for inclusion in the Style HUD
- Everything hosted on their own servers, so that if/when those shut down all TMP bodies and heads will be rendered useless: at best stuck in the last skin/outfits used, at worst... who knows?
- Dev team rumoured to have split, so no future updates
